Use an ATS to manage candidate pipelines and report on hiring metrics. An HRIS is the system of record for employee data, critical for onboarding and lifecycle management. Benefits platforms automate enrollment, payroll deductions, and compliance reporting.
Structured interviewing uses standardized questions and scoring rubrics to reduce bias. TComp analysis evaluates an offer's full value (salary + benefits + equity) to benchmark competitively. The I-9 process is a mandatory U.S. legal procedure; mastering its deadlines and document requirements is non-negotiable for compliance.
Answer Strategy
The candidate must demonstrate strict procedural knowledge and risk-aware communication. Strategy: State the legal obligation first, then the immediate steps, and finally the long-term process fix. Sample answer: 'First, I would follow the legal requirement: the individual cannot begin work until Section 2 of the Form I-9 is completed with acceptable documents. I would meet with them privately to explain the issue and provide the standard three-business-day window to present valid documentation. If they cannot, we must rescind the offer to maintain compliance. Post-incident, I would audit our pre-boarding communication to ensure candidates are clearly instructed on required documentation.'
